EN

Siobhan Hunter, Peter North - Splatterhouse Eighteen

  • 2013-03-01
  • 8:59

Related Siobhan Hunter, Peter North -... Videos

Keisha  Peter NorthKeisha Peter North
2017-05-14 11:12